clientupdate: cache CanAutoUpdate, avoid log spam when false
I noticed logs on one of my machines where it can't auto-update with scary log spam about "failed to apply tailnet-wide default for auto-updates". This avoids trying to do the EditPrefs if we know it's just going to fail anyway.
